Grays Harbor Sheriff’s deputies responded to an average of 54 calls per day during the first month of 2024. Officials released call data information this week showing the number of calls responded to in the unincorporated parts of the county. There were 403 traffic stops made last month, 20 theft related calls and 11 burglary calls. When looking at total calls, deputies responded to 1,693 calls in January.
